Analysis of the thermal variation of the magnetic properties of neodymium ethyl sulfate

An analysis of the observed thermal variation of the magnetic susceptibilities of Nd-ethyl-sulfate is made based on the crystal field obtained by Gruber and Satten in order to explain the observed Stark pattern in the electronic spectra of NdES. Intermediate coupling wave-functions and the corresponding reduced matrix elements have been used and the J-mixing has been taken into consideration as far as the Stark energies are concerned. The theoretical g11 is in good agreement with that obtained from magnetic resonance. It is found that the theoretical expressions for both psisub(11) and psisub(1) give excellent fit to the measured thermal variation of the susceptibilities from 287.5 K to 4.2 K. A single suitable crystal field accounts well for the observed magnetic data over a wide range of temperature. (author)
